The Quality Factor: What Makes a Chocolate Brand Stand Out?

Quality is everything when it comes to chocolate. Sure, you can have flashy packaging and trendy flavors, but if the chocolate itself doesn’t deliver, it’s all for naught. So, what defines quality in the world of holiday candy? Here are a few key factors:

  • Cocoa Percentage: Higher cocoa content often means richer flavor and better quality.
  • Ingredients: Look for brands that use real cocoa butter and natural ingredients.
  • Texture: A good chocolate should melt smoothly in your mouth without being grainy or waxy.

Now, let’s apply these criteria to our top brands. Ghirardelli, for instance, prides itself on using high-quality ingredients and a meticulous production process. Lindt, on the other hand, is known for its silky smooth texture and complex flavor profiles. But does this mean Hershey’s falls short? Not necessarily. It all depends on what you’re looking for in a chocolate experience.

Flavor Profiles: Which Brand Offers the Best Taste?

Let’s talk flavors. Holiday candy isn’t just about plain old chocolate. It’s about experimenting with unique and festive flavors. Peppermint, gingerbread, eggnog—you name it, and there’s probably a chocolate version of it. But which brand does it best?

Ghirardelli’s Peppermint Bark is legendary. It’s a perfect blend of dark chocolate, creamy white chocolate, and crunchy peppermint pieces. Lindt’s Gingerbread Liqueur Truffles are another standout, offering a warm, spicy kick that’s perfect for the holidays. Meanwhile, Hershey’s keeps it classic with their Milk Chocolate with Caramel and Pretzel Bars, which are surprisingly delicious.

Ferrero Rocher: A Holiday Staple

Of course, we can’t talk about holiday chocolate without mentioning Ferrero Rocher. These golden-wrapped wonders have become a holiday tradition for many. Each piece is a little masterpiece—crispy hazelnut surrounded by smooth gianduja cream and covered in milk chocolate. It’s a flavor experience that’s hard to beat, especially during the festive season.

Sustainability: Is Your Favorite Brand Ethical?

In today’s world, sustainability is more important than ever. Consumers are becoming increasingly conscious of where their food comes from and how it’s made. So, how do our top brands stack up in terms of ethical practices?

Ghirardelli has made significant strides in sustainability, committing to sourcing 100% certified cocoa by 2025. Lindt, too, has launched initiatives to improve the livelihoods of cocoa farmers. Meanwhile, Hershey’s has its own program called “Cocoa For Good,” which focuses on improving sustainability and community development.
